This Crucial Stages for Innovative Offering Development
Successfully launching a innovative solution demands a well-defined innovation process. First , perform thorough consumer analysis to pinpoint unmet needs and potential opportunities. Next , develop a selection of prototypes and diligently assess them against established standards. Afterward , enhance the top design into a complete plan, specifying features, functionality , and buyer persona. After that, produce a basic prototype for validation with potential customers . Finally , based on the feedback received , finalize the solution and prepare its release into the industry .
- Consumer Analysis
- Idea Generation
- Offering Specification
- MVP Evaluation
- Release Preparation

New Product Development: Best Practices for Success
Successfully introducing a new product requires more than just a great idea. A robust new product development should incorporate several vital best approaches to maximize the likelihood of achievement .
First, thorough market analysis is critically crucial to identify customer desires and validate the viability of your concept . This requires conducting interviews , analyzing rival products, and evaluating the prevailing market situation.
Furthermore, a organized methodology to phased development is necessary. This allows for regular new product development process reviews, refinements , and timely detection of possible problems.
- Focus customer feedback throughout the full development cycle .
- Foster cross-functional cooperation between design, marketing, and sales teams.
- Ensure responsiveness to shifting market conditions .
- Define specific goals and indicators for offering performance.
Finally, don't the necessity of post-launch tracking and refinement . A prosperous product is rarely perfect out of the gate and calls for persistent enhancement .
